Назад | Перейти на главную страницу

Неверная команда "SSLEngine" Centos

Я удалил Apache и переустановил его, и теперь, когда я пытаюсь запустить его, я получаю следующую ошибку:

Syntax error on line 94 of /usr/local/psa/admin/conf/generated/13636697550.95452800_server.include:
Invalid command 'SSLEngine', perhaps misspelled or defined by a module not included in the server configuration

Я не пробовал включать SSL или еще что-нибудь. Я новичок в Linux и Apache в целом, поэтому, если бы кто-нибудь мог мне с этим помочь, я был бы бесконечно благодарен.

Возможно, в /etc/httpd/conf или /etc/httpd/conf.d. Найти (grep SSL /etc/httpd/{conf,conf.d} -r) и уничтожьте его или установите ssl-модуль для Apache:

yum install mod_ssl

В моем случае у меня был установлен mod_ssl, но он не был включен. Для этого я запустил:

sudo a2enmod ssl

Убедитесь, что вы уже загрузили mod_ssl в файл httpd.conf:

LoadModule ssl_module modules/mod_ssl.so